JERUSALEM, Jan. 23 (Xinhua) -- Israel has launched a national plan for shadowing and cooling the urban environment, according to a joint statement issued Sunday by Israel's Ministry of Environmental Protection and the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development.

The plan, at a total of 2.25 billion shekels (about 716 million U.S. dollars), includes the planting of about 450,000 trees along about 3 million meters of streets by 2040.

The plan, aiming to prepare for climate changes, was approved by the Israeli government after submitted by Prime Minister Naftali Bennett, Minister of Environmental Protection Tamar Zandberg and Minister of Agriculture Oded Forer.

The trees will be planted following artificial intelligence mapping of the existing tree shade cover in the local authorities.

"The trees will also significantly reduce heat spots, protect from heavy rains and reduce further negative consequences of climate change and pollution," according to the statement.
